Approaches Applied Online for Practical Change
Egypt uses Cognitive Behavioral Therapy to help clients identify unhelpful thought patterns and develop concrete skills for managing anxiety, mood problems, and stress. She also integrates EMDR for clients processing traumatic memories, using structured, trauma-focused work to reduce the distress linked to past events. Additionally, her client-centered orientation keeps the focus on each person’s values and priorities, creating a collaborative space for goal setting and skill building.
Finding the right approach is part of the therapeutic process, and Egypt works together with clients to determine which methods fit their needs, goals, and comfort level. She tailors the balance of CBT, EMDR, motivational strategies, or solution-focused techniques based on ongoing feedback and evolving preferences so clients remain active partners in planning their care.
Online therapy with Egypt is offered through multiple formats including video calls, phone sessions, live chat, and text-based messaging, which supports flexibility for people with busy schedules or limited local options. These remote options make it easier to maintain continuity of care, try different therapeutic techniques, and access support from Maryland or other locations.
